About Douglass Academy High School
Douglass Academy High School is a public high school in Chicago, IL, part of Chicago Public Schools Dist 299, serving approximately 37 students in grades 9th-12th with a 4.6: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 7.2 out of 10 and ranks #1,083 of 3,813 schools in IL. State assessment records show 13%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2021) and 16%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).
